    Test Lead
    Location – Cincinnati, OH ( 5 days onsite)

    Support commercial banking digital channels by validating new features, backend integrations, and payment workflows to ensure high-quality customer experiences.
    • Lead testing and quality assurance activities for payment rail migrations, including ISO 20022 transitions, RTP/FedNow integrations, and ACH/wire routing enhancements.
    • Contribute to the delivery of new Move Money capabilities across ACH, wires, real-time payments, Zelle, and internal transfers, ensuring compliance with regulatory and bank standards.
    • Collaborate closely with development, product, and payment operations teams to troubleshoot issues, optimize API/backend flows, and drive end-to-end validation across systems.
    • Ensure platform stability through regression testing, automation strategies, and quality best practices that support scalability of payments and commercial channel experiences.
    • Lead QA planning and execution across manual, automated, unit, API, functional, and regression testing.

    • Collaborate with Product, UX/UI, and Engineering teams to define quality standards and testing strategy.
    • Develop and execute test plans, test cases, and test data; manage test data requests.
    • Track test progress in qTest and manage defects, triage, and resolution in Digital.ai.
    • Monitor QA KPIs and drive continuous quality improvements for smooth release delivery.
    Define test architecture, automation strategy, and quality engineering approach in alignment with project and business goals.
    • Collaborate with product owners, solution architects, and technical leads to understanding system design and manage test alignment.
    • Review and guide offshore test design, automation frameworks, and technical implementation of outputs.
    • Lead defect triage discussions, support root cause analysis, and provide architectural direction on testing challenges.
    • Communicate test status, metrics, risks, and architectural recommendations to Bank stakeholders.
